Creating a Respectful Workplace

Respect is an important value in business, especially for the many companies that work in teams. Because we have coworkers who are different from us and may not share the same background or opinions, honoring differences plays a critical role in ensuring effective collaboration and teamwork. Part of learning about respectful behavior is learning more about yourself. We’ll help you build self-awareness so you can better manage your responses to challenging situations and be able to respect yourself and colleagues in a way that welcomes each person’s uniqueness.

In this course, you will explore how to build self-awareness and confront implicit biases. This course shares skills that can help guide the way you interact with others, whether they share your values or not. We will review inclusive active listening, empathy, addressing cognitive distortions, and mindfulness. By the end of this course, you will discover how you can promote respectful behavior, language, and collaboration in the workplace.
